French Links Tours
       
Website www.frenchlinks.com
Year Established 1995
Program Description Tours of France that include history, art, architecture, gastronomy, horticulture, literature, fashion & antiques shopping.
Number of Programs/Year 1,000
Program Length 1/2 day or more
Group Size or S:T Ratio 2-125
Program Focus Culture/History/Heritage, Literature, Nature/Science, Art/Architecture/Design
Faculty Rachel Kaplan, author of 5 books including Little-Known Museums In and Around Paris, London, Berlin and Rome. She has lectured at art institutions, galleries and museums, and has made radio and TV appearances.
Costs From $660/half day, from $1,000/full day in Paris; from $1,500/full day outside Paris. Personalized multi-day travel programs available.
Global Locations France
Months Year round
